md.texi (Standard Names): Change insn pattern name from truncM2 to btruncM2 for ...
authorUros Bizjak <uros@kss-loka.si>
Sat, 18 Jun 2005 15:21:19 +0000 (17:21 +0200)
committerEric Botcazou <ebotcazou@gcc.gnu.org>
Sat, 18 Jun 2005 15:21:19 +0000 (15:21 +0000)
* doc/md.texi (Standard Names): Change insn pattern name
from truncM2 to btruncM2 for 'trunc' built-in description.
Add rintM2 insn pattern description.

From-SVN: r101159

gcc/ChangeLog
gcc/doc/md.texi

index 8aab0c70591689922c63e4a3f9e2d61e7cee4dcf..2fefbb6f94e5aea0e634e19eac463fcf73282c5d 100644 (file)
@@ -1,3 +1,9 @@
+2005-06-18  Uros Bizjak  <uros@kss-loka.si>
+
+       * doc/md.texi (Standard Names): Change insn pattern name
+       from truncM2 to btruncM2 for 'trunc' built-in description.
+       Add rintM2 insn pattern description.
+
 2005-06-18  Kaveh R. Ghazi  <ghazi@caip.rutgers.edu>
 
        * c-decl.c (locate_old_decl): Add format attribute.
index 81f5ebcf38e316cd18c28d244aa817c8ed3706eb..6a3b76e3fde9ced9551a39cb9ebdd265e927f1c8 100644 (file)
@@ -3100,8 +3100,8 @@ corresponds to the C data type @code{double} and the @code{floorf}
 built-in function uses the mode which corresponds to the C data
 type @code{float}.
 
-@cindex @code{trunc@var{m}2} instruction pattern
-@item @samp{trunc@var{m}2}
+@cindex @code{btrunc@var{m}2} instruction pattern
+@item @samp{btrunc@var{m}2}
 Store the argument rounded to integer towards zero.
 
 The @code{trunc} built-in function of C always uses the mode which
@@ -3136,6 +3136,17 @@ corresponds to the C data type @code{double} and the @code{nearbyintf}
 built-in function uses the mode which corresponds to the C data
 type @code{float}.
 
+@cindex @code{rint@var{m}2} instruction pattern
+@item @samp{rint@var{m}2}
+Store the argument rounded according to the default rounding mode and
+raise the inexact exception when the result differs in value from
+the argument
+
+The @code{rint} built-in function of C always uses the mode which
+corresponds to the C data type @code{double} and the @code{rintf}
+built-in function uses the mode which corresponds to the C data
+type @code{float}.
+
 @cindex @code{ffs@var{m}2} instruction pattern
 @item @samp{ffs@var{m}2}
 Store into operand 0 one plus the index of the least significant 1-bit